NCAA Settlement Delayed Over Roster Limit Issues
Background
The NCAA is currently facing a delay in a significant settlement due to complications surrounding roster limit issues. This development has raised concerns among attorneys about the potential for widespread disruption within collegiate sports.
Key Issues
- Roster Limit Complications: The primary issue causing the delay is the complexity of adjusting roster limits, which are crucial for maintaining fair competition and ensuring compliance with NCAA regulations.
- Legal Concerns: Attorneys involved in the case have expressed worries that unresolved roster limit issues could lead to legal challenges and further complications.
- Impact on Athletes: The delay could affect student-athletes’ eligibility and scholarship opportunities, creating uncertainty for many involved in collegiate sports.
Potential Consequences
Attorneys warn that if the settlement is not resolved promptly, it could lead to chaos within the NCAA framework. This includes potential disruptions in athletic programs and challenges in maintaining equitable opportunities for student-athletes.
